A fake soldier by name Milo Pierre has been apprehended alongside a gang of armed robbers, some of who were dressed in military uniform in Yaoundé, Centre Region of Cameroon.
The gang was apprehended by the elements of the territorial gendarmerie of Mfoundi on June 26, 2022.
It is reported that the gang intended to rob a micro-finance bank when the plan was leaked, leading to their arrest.
Lt. Col. Parfait Ayessi of the territorial gendarmerie of Mfoundi while addressing the press, urged the population to be more vigilant and conscious while dealing with suspicious military officials.
“We call on the population to notify us when they happen to meet someone who presents himself as a military official but portrays a questionable behaviour,” Lt. Col. Ayessi said.
The suspects were apprehended with dangerous weapons including guns.
Amongst the gang members was a young man who had been released from jail barely few days prior to the arrest.
